Abstract

Subject. This article examines the relationship between marketing activities and the development of entrepreneurial structures in Russia. Objectives. The article aims to develop a methodological approach that helps optimize the product nomenclature and develop differentiated marketing strategies for managing sales in different segments. Methods. For the study, I used the methods of ABC/XYZ and cluster analyses. Results. The article offers a methodological approach to the analysis of the nomenclature of goods, tested on the data of one of the business structures of the Crimean wine industry. It identifies goods nomenclature clusters that have similar dynamic characteristics for changes in sales volumes and demand predictability, and provides recommendations for increasing sales, margins, and improving enterprise competitiveness. Conclusions. The developed methodological approach can be considered as an element of information and methodological support for the enterprise competitiveness management system.
